Trade Nation has emerged as a significant player in the forex market since its inception in 2014. Known for its low-cost trading and transparent pricing, Trade Nation offers a robust platform for traders looking to navigate the complexities of global currency markets. | Established | Regulatory Authority | Headquarters | Minimum Deposit | Leverage Ratio | Average Spread |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2014 | FCA, ASIC, FCSA | London, UK | $0 | Up to 1:200 | From 0.6 pips |
Trade Nation operates under strict regulations from prominent financial authorities, including the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) in the UK and the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C). The broker's no minimum deposit requirement makes it accessible to a wide range of traders. With leverage ratios reaching up to 1:200, traders can maximize their exposure to the forex market.
In comparison to industry standards, Trade Nation's average spread of 0.6 pips on major currency pairs is competitive, especially when considering its fixed spread model. This ensures that traders know their costs upfront, allowing for better risk management.
Trade Nation offers a variety of trading platforms, including its proprietary TN Trader platform and the widely used MetaTrader 4 (MT4).
| Currency Pair Category | Number Offered | Minimum Spread | Trading Hours | Commission Structure |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Major Pairs | 30+ | From 0.6 pips | 24/5 | None |
| Minor Pairs | 20+ | From 1.0 pips | 24/5 | None |
| Exotic Pairs | 10+ | From 3.0 pips | 24/5 | None |
The execution speed on Trade Nation's platforms is commendable, with minimal slippage reported by users. This efficiency is crucial for traders who rely on timely entries and exits to maximize their trading strategies.
Trade Nation prioritizes client fund security by maintaining segregated accounts and employing advanced encryption technologies to protect personal data. Additionally, the broker offers negative balance protection, ensuring that traders do not lose more than their account balance.
